If the scope falls under the ones Armament Tech will handle you should be okay. I bought a used Heritage 3-15x several years ago off the PX, did good for me. Last year I sent it in for a going over prior to selling it, they said it needed parts that were no longer available. For $1200 they upgraded me to a TT525P.
